I'm trying to enable a webview within a xamarin forms app to get the current GPS coordinates of an android device. Currently the webview/website will return the GPS coordinates when opened in a chrome browser on the phone or a laptop, however within the app will not. Trying to get this working as simply as possible and to expand on it after.
Code so far: XAML page:
<?xml version="1.0" encoding="utf-8" ?>
<ContentPage xmlns="http://xamarin.com/schemas/2014/forms"
xmlns:x="http://schemas.microsoft.com/winfx/2009/xaml"
x:Class="UITrial.Page2"
BackgroundColor = "#f0f0ea">
<Label Text="{Binding MainText}" VerticalOptions="Center" HorizontalOptions="Center" />
<WebView Source="https://danu6.it.nuigalway.ie/OliverInternetProgramming/project/Loginproject.html" />
</ContentPage>
HTML PAGE:
<!DOCTYPE html>
<html>
<body>
<p>Click the button to get your coordinates.</p>
<button onclick="getLocation()">Try It</button>
<p id="demo"></p>
<script>
var x = document.getElementById("demo");
function getLocation() {
if (navigator.geolocation) {
navigator.geolocation.watchPosition(showPosition);
} else {
x.innerHTML = "Geolocation is not supported by this browser.";}
}
function showPosition(position) {
x.innerHTML="Latitude: " + position.coords.latitude +
"<br>Longitude: " + position.coords.longitude;
}
</script>
</body>
</html>

You need to use a custom WebChromeClient
for WebView
in Droid project. Please refer to Android WebView Geolocation.
In Xamarin.Forms you can follow the below steps to accomplish this:
Create a custom Control for WebView in PCL project:
public class GeoWebView:WebView
{
}
And use it in Xaml:
<ContentPage xmlns="http://xamarin.com/schemas/2014/forms"
xmlns:x="http://schemas.microsoft.com/winfx/2009/xaml"
xmlns:local="clr-namespace:WebViewFormsDemo"
x:Class="WebViewFormsDemo.MainPage">
<local:GeoWebView
Source="https://danu6.it.nuigalway.ie/OliverInternetProgramming/project/Loginproject.html"></local:GeoWebView>
Create a Custom Renderer for GeoWebView
in Droid Project like below:
[assembly:ExportRenderer(typeof(GeoWebView),typeof(GeoWebViewRenderer))]
namespace WebViewFormsDemo.Droid
{
public class GeoWebViewRenderer:WebViewRenderer
{
protected override void OnElementChanged(ElementChangedEventArgs<Xamarin.Forms.WebView> e)
{
base.OnElementChanged(e);
Control.Settings.JavaScriptEnabled = true;
Control.SetWebChromeClient(new MyWebClient());
}
}
public class MyWebClient : WebChromeClient
{
public override void OnGeolocationPermissionsShowPrompt(string origin, GeolocationPermissions.ICallback callback)
{
callback.Invoke(origin, true, false);
}
}
}
Add Permissions to AndroidManifest.xml
:
<uses-permission android:name="android.permission.ACCESS_FINE_LOCATION" />
Then you will get your location in webview correctly.
Cheers Elvis managed to get everything working, had to make some minor changes so will post everything I did in detail:
In App.xaml.cs:
using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using Xamarin.Forms;
namespace WebViewFormsDemo
{
public partial class App : Application
{
public App()
{
InitializeComponent();
MainPage = new MainPage();
}
protected override void OnStart()
{
// Handle when your app starts
}
protected override void OnSleep()
{
// Handle when your app sleeps
}
protected override void OnResume()
{
// Handle when your app resumes
}
}
}
In MainPage.xaml ensure that your website is 'https'
<?xml version="1.0" encoding="utf-8" ?>
<ContentPage xmlns="http://xamarin.com/schemas/2014/forms"
xmlns:x="http://schemas.microsoft.com/winfx/2009/xaml"
xmlns:local="clr-namespace:WebViewFormsDemo"
x:Class="WebViewFormsDemo.MainPage">
<local:GeoWebView
Source="https:// --- Your Website ----></local:GeoWebView>
</ContentPage>
As Elvis said then need to create a custom control in the PLC project. Right click and add new 'Class' to do this.
using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Threading.Tasks;
using Xamarin.Forms;
namespace WebViewFormsDemo
{
public class GeoWebView : WebView
{
}
}
Following this create a Custom Render in the Droid Class. Had some errors here initially, mostly with missing 'using' directives and also with keywords needed in the 'assembly'.
using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using Android.App;
using Android.Content;
using Android.OS;
using Android.Runtime;
using Android.Views;
using Android.Widget;
using Xamarin.Forms;
using Xamarin.Forms.Platform.Android;
using Android.Webkit;
[assembly: ExportRenderer(typeof(WebViewFormsDemo.GeoWebView), typeof(WebViewFormsDemo.Droid.GeoWebViewRenderer))]
namespace WebViewFormsDemo.Droid
{
public class GeoWebViewRenderer : WebViewRenderer
{
protected override void OnElementChanged(ElementChangedEventArgs<Xamarin.Forms.WebView> e)
{
base.OnElementChanged(e);
Control.Settings.JavaScriptEnabled = true;
Control.SetWebChromeClient(new MyWebClient());
}
}
public class MyWebClient : WebChromeClient
{
public override void OnGeolocationPermissionsShowPrompt(string origin, GeolocationPermissions.ICallback callback)
{
callback.Invoke(origin, true, false);
}
}
}
Following these changes everything worked perfectly. Thanks again Elvis!
